How To Load MP3s Onto Your iPod Without iTunes

Although we’ve all known it was possible to load up music onto your iPod without iTunes, here’s a great guide from Lifehacker listing all the steps in extensive detail.

If you’re at all jumpy about possibly screwing up your $249 music player by not using iTunes (which you probably can’t anyway), follow Adam’s guide and you’ll be able to put music from your PC, your laptop, your kid’s PC, and even your machine at work without all the syncing and resyncing that iTunes asks you to do.
